Is a basil vegan?

A basil is a vegan food ingredient.

So, what is a basil?

Basil, also known as sweet basil, is a popular herb with a distinct, sweet aroma and flavor. It is a member of the mint family and has green, glossy leaves that are slightly oval in shape. Basil is commonly used in Italian cuisine, particularly in tomato-based dishes like pizza and pasta sauce. It is also a key ingredient in pesto and is often used to flavor soups, stews, and salads. Basil is rich in antioxidants and has anti-inflammatory properties, making it a popular herb in traditional medicine. Additionally, it is easy to grow and can be grown both indoors and outdoors in a variety of climates.
